Originally Posted by whodini
The AWA's and the Sami's look the sickest but the masa definitely seems to hold its own compared to the rest, especially the 2010's.

I'd say the denim is a step up from standard Nudies, but still doesn't seem like anything spectacular. To be perfectly honest I don't think there's a whole lot there to justify paying full price for them - no hidden rivets or extra selvedge anywhere, no special buttons or lined back pockets, etc. Just none of the little stuff you'd expect at their price point. All you get is the flags on the inside back of the waistband. Who knows though, maybe being made in Japan gives them some kind of crazy magic fading properties - time will tell, I guess. I haven't really seen any pics of them with heavy wear.

What really drew me to them is the cut. IMO that's the great thing about visiting Denimbar - I never would have thought I'd like this type of cut if Mauro hadn't suggested I try them on. Seeing pics online of others in different styles is great, but it's no substitute for being in the store yourself, trying a ton of different denim on and seeing what looks good on you.
